Effects of Oxyamylose and Polyacrylic Acid on Foot-and-Mouth Disease and Hog Cholera Virus Infections

Two interferon-inducing polycarboxylates were tested for antiviral activity on foot-and-mouth disease (FMD) virus infections in mice, guinea pigs, and swine.
